Peace is a fleeting gift, and one that never appears for long. After centuries of peace, a once long forgotten prophecy now eats away at the fragile civility of the provinces of Elsmera. War seems on the horizon, but is all hope lost? In the country's greatest time of need, where will help come from? Perhaps it comes from the hearts of a motley group of adventurers, or a boy destined for greatness.
